What Is Fort?

Fort is a deck-building game for 2 to 4 players, ages 10 and up, and takes about 20 to 40 minutes to play. It is currently available for pre-order from Leder Games for $30 (plus shipping), with an expected retail release date of August 25. (I’ll note that the gameplay will be a bit longer when you’re still learning the game, but 20–40 minutes seems reasonable for players who no longer need to consult the player aid for the various action icons. Currently my 2-player games still take about 30 minutes.)

Fort was designed by Grant Rodiek (and originally self-published in a different form as SPQF). It was developed by Nick Brachmann for Leder Games, with illustrations by Kyle Ferrin.
